> The question of how to make mulled wine comes up every now and then. I
> ran into this recipe in a book "Christmas in the Old West" by Sam Travers
> and thought I might share it.
>
> Mulled Wine: Grate one half Nutmeg into a Pint of Wine and Sweeten to
> your Taste with Loaf-sugar. Set it over the fire and when it boils take
> it off the fire to cool. Beat the yolks of four eggs very well, strain
> them and add to them a little cold wine, them [sic] mix them with hot wine
> gradually. Pour it backward and forward several times till it looks fine
> and light, then set it on the fire and heat it very gradually till it is
> quite hot and pretty thick and pour it up and down several times. Put it
> in chocolate cups and serve it with long narrow toast. (1801)
